Datamonitor's commercial banks profile groups together diversified and regional commercial banks. Commercial banks are defined as those banks whose business is derived primarily from commercial lending operations but which are also present in the retail banking and small and medium corporate lending industry sectors. Thus, the values provided in this profile cover the banking industry as a whole. The data in this report measures the total assets held by all banks. The geographical segmentation measures the total assets held in each region, regardless of the origin of the banks holding them. The market share is also given according to assets held. Any currency conversions used in the creation of this report have been calculated using constant 2007 annual average exchange rates. For the purpose of this report the Americas comprises Argentina, Brazil, Canada, Chile, Colombia, Mexico, Venezuela, and the US. Europe comprises Belgium, the Czech Republic, Denmark, France, Germany, Hungary, Italy, Netherlands, Norway, Poland, Russia, Spain, Sweden and the UK. Asia-Pacific comprises Australia, China, Japan, India, Singapore, South Korea and Taiwan. The global figure comprises the Americas, Asia-Pacific and Europe. Table of Contents
